Fire! Fire! Fire!

So, what a way to be woken up this morning at about 0430! A ton of smoke and a loud pop! My roommate, Jay, woke me up and told me that the room was on fire! I could barely breath. I jumped up and threw on my clothes and started running around. He tried putting it out with a towel, but that didn't work for him. In our room we have a "closet", which used to be a shower room. In that room is where the SIPR and NIPR switches are held. We don't use the room and never go in there.
Apparently a switch or outlet or whatever it used to be had shorted, being the cause of the fire. Now, KBR is in charge of the electrical shit around here, which no one likes. If you search the news, KBR is already responsible for a few servicemen deaths, by faulty electrical work. Don't believe me, look it up. No one can stand KBR, but for now, they are the only company capable of doing the contract which they continuously win.And of course the first words out of KBR's mouth was that it was the TCF's fault for overloading the switch. BULLSHIT! They run the shit in that room, yeah, but that room hasn't changed in all the damn time that I've been here, so why now? Everyone called it too, that KBR would put the blame on someone else. My roommate and I could have been toast if it had gotten way out of hand. He was going to use the fire extinguser on the fire, but we talked about it and decided not to, because of the electronic equipment in there, we weren't sure that it would harm it or not. So, I called the KVFD, which is right behind us and they came over. They had to drive over, so in that time, I got the same towel that Jay had tried to use and I went in the room with the fire and put it out. The air was filled with fine black soot, or whatever, which is all over every freaking thing! I wiped my face and it was black, the inside of my nose was black and my white t-shirt wasn't so white anymore. The smell was/is horrible too!So, yeah, it was a very eventful morning!
